Italy hosts kite and balloon festivals in August
On August 1‑2, the third edition of the Festival degli Aquiloni took place on the shores of Lake Santa Croce in Belluno, organized by Comitato Alpago 2 Ruote & Solidarietà, the municipality of Alpago and Eventi Volanti. Professional kite flyers displayed large three‑dimensional kites up to 400 m², as well as classic kites, and featured a 6‑metre‑tall Giant Giraffe and a 4‑metre‑tall Majestic Elephant. The Italian National Aerobatic Flight Team performed aerial maneuvers using multi‑line kites.
Meanwhile, the Umbria Balloon Festival continued in Todi, with hot‑air balloon flights beginning on July 31 and running through August 2. The event, organized by BilBenefit and Aeroclub Trasimeno under the direction of Donatella Ricci, attracted about twenty crews from Italy, South Africa, Croatia, Sweden, Spain and the United Kingdom. Spectators enjoyed night balloon displays, music and tastings in Piazza del Popolo, and the festival plans to present its next edition at the TTG fair in Rimini.
